The Influential Women of Bitcoin: Female Instagram Influencers to Watch

The world of bitcoin and cryptocurrency has seen a significant rise in popularity in recent years, and with it, the number of women who have made a name for themselves in this field. Instagram, as a platform, has become a powerful tool for these influencers to share their knowledge, experiences, and insights with a global audience. In this article, we will showcase some of the most influential female bitcoin and cryptocurrency influencers on Instagram, who are making a difference in the world of blockchain and crypto.

1. Sarah Ruddy (@bitcoin_girl)

Sarah Ruddy, also known as @bitcoin_girl on Instagram, is a UK-based bitcoin and cryptocurrency expert, investor, and entrepreneur. With over 28,000 followers, she has become a go-to resource for those looking to understand the intricacies of bitcoin and blockchain technology. Her unique approach to teaching and engaging with her audience has earned her a loyal following, and her insights have made her a trusted voice in the world of crypto.

2. Laura Shin (@laurashin)

Laura Shin is an American journalist, author, and podcast host who has been covering the bitcoin and cryptocurrency landscape for over a decade. Her podcast, "Unchained," has featured interviews with some of the most prominent names in the industry, and her writing has appeared in publications such as The New York Times, The Atlantic, and The Verge. With over 15,000 followers, she has become an essential resource for those seeking in-depth coverage of the bitcoin and crypto world.
